ABSTRACT

This paper is a comprehensive discussion of following three papers: An Even Number Divisible by 6 could be Expressed as the Sum of Several Groups of Two Prime Numbers[1], Research on an Even Number Which Plus 2 Can be Exactly Divided by 6 Can be Expressed as the Sum of Several Sets of Two Prime Numbers[2], Research on an Even Number Which Minus 2 Can be Exactly Divided by 6 Can be Expressed as the Sum of Several Sets of Two Prime Numbers[3], which is published in sections with too long solution. In this paper, the relationship between the number D of even P(1,1) prime number pairs and the number L of twin prime numbers smaller than the even number is synthesized, and the characteristics of the P(1,1) prime number pairs and the characteristics of the group number of prime pairs are analyzed, and the factors affecting the number of P(1,1) prime number pairs are analyzed. The Formulas of P(1,1) prime pairs using the number of twin primes less than the even number is given and the Goldbach Conjecture is proved valid.
